Abstract (EN)
Fırat River and dam lakes build on its have been used as drinkinking water source by many settlement. Municipalities surrounded on this area plan this river as future drinking water source.Fırat River has been polluted by the different sources. The municipalities on this area has directly discharged their wastewater to Fırat River or the dam lakes. In addition, both agricultural and industrial activities have been affected Fırat River polluted.In this study, microfiltration and reverse osmosis were used for treatment of Keban Dam Lake water. Some parameters on influent and effluent such as pH, alkalinity, conductivity, hardness, TOC and potential of disinfection byproduct formation were monitored.The microfiltration membrane with pore sizes of 1, 5 and 10 mikron was used and the reverse osmosis was operated at pressures of 11, 11.5 and 12.1 atm The parameters such as alkalinity, hardness, UV, TOC and DBPs were removed about 95 %. Fırat River can be used as drinking water source after treatment and microbiology analysis.
